"Dr. Eleonora Bass earned her Doctor of Psychology in Clinical Psychology from William James College and a Master of Arts in Mental Health Counseling from Boston College. Eleonora Bass is a licensed psychologist and owner of Behavioral Evaluation Services of Texas. She has over 14 years of experience doing evaluations as well as individual, group, and family therapy with children. Dr. Eleonora Bass completed her clinical training in Houston, Texas, Costa Rica, Israel, and Ecuador. She provides a complete, evidence-based approach to psychological testing. She has worked in a wide range of settings, including IOP/PHP, therapeutic schools, community health centers, bilingual low-income services, and private practice. She is a member of the Texas Psychological Association and the Collin County Psychological Association. Dr. Eleonora Bass is fluent in Italian, Russian, English, and Spanish. She is a founder and clinical supervisor of the behavioral evaluation services in Texas. She and her team can explain your diagnosis and presenting symptoms and identify an evidence-based treatment plan for success.

"Dr. Amy Kreins received her Doctoral Degree in Clinical Psychology with an emphasis in Health Psychology at the California School of Professional Psychology in Fresno, CA. She completed her predoctoral internship at Virginia Tech's Cook Counseling Center and her postdoctoral fellowship at UC Santa Cruz's Student Counseling Center. Dr. Amy Kreins is a member of the Collin County Psychological Association and the American Psychological Association. She is the owner and operator of Kreins Psychological Services, as well as the Lead Psychologist. She provides safe, welcoming spaces so clients, of all ages and backgrounds can move forward and start living the lives they desire. Dr. Amy Kreins provides Cognitive-Behavioral Therapy (CBT) and other evidence-based treatments to adults, seniors, and teens with a wide range of emotional, behavioral, and adjustment problems. Kreins Psychological Services delivers therapy and assessment services for a variety of issues. Dr. Amy Kreins also uses mindfulness training to help her clients live in the moment. Her approach is compassionate and nonjudgmental.

"Dr. Janice Caudill completed her Ph.D. in counseling psychology from Texas Woman's University. Her therapeutic approach is practical and effective, and she values the significance of family and relationships. Dr. Caudill specializes in helping individuals and couples recover from infidelity, and she assists her clients in developing practical action plans to address challenges, enhance their relationships, and overcome personal and relational obstacles. Dr. Janice Caudill is extremely knowledgeable and is up-to-date on the latest medical trends. She adapts her methods to meet the unique needs of her clients. She is dedicated to helping her clients resolve issues and make positive changes to problematic beliefs, thoughts, compulsions, and emotions. Dr. Janice Caudill specializes in treating sex addiction and partner betrayal trauma utilizing individual, couple, and group formats.
